As far as I am aware this is the only signed piece of ephemera to have escaped from the two or three major, vacuum-sealed REH collections in more than 20 years. The photo comes from the Emil Petaja estste. The author of 13 novels and more than 100 short stories in 1995, Petaja was named the first ever Author Emeritus by the Science Fiction Writers of America. A Finnish-American, Petaja was a contemporary of REH and a contributor to WEIRD TALES. He corresponded with the CONAN author, H.P. Lovecraft, Clark Ashton Smith and other writers from the magazine's stable. When Petaja died in 2000, his collection of pulp-era correspondence/artifacts -- a veritable treasure trove of such material -- was broken up and sold. Never ceases to amaze me how this photo has survived the years virtually unscathed -- no yellowing, no mildew stains, no bends or tears. The photo is also an important REH association item (as rare book collectors call these things). Petaja is the fella Robert E. Howard sent the typescript of his poem CIMMERIA to in February, 1932. According to REH's handwritten note to Petaja on the typescript, the poem was: "Written in Mission, Texas, February 1932; suggested by the memory of the hill-country above Fredricksburg seen in a mist of winter rain". A fully-realised Conan sprang from REH's fecund brow simultaneously to inhabit the "land of Darkness and deep Night" he described in the poem. The rest is pop culture history.
